A man in his 30s who was shot by the police after shooting his son’s mother’s friend in an East Side apartment died, according to San Antonio police chief William McManus.

Police were called to the East Meadow Apartments at block 1200 on North Walters Street on Friday night.

McManus said the man in his 30s confronted his son’s mother’s friend and then shot him. A policeman who was nearby arrived moments later and found the suspect in the shooting.

The policeman confronted the man, and the suspect in the shooting drew his gun, McManus said.

After that, the officer stepped back and called for backup as he followed the suspect in the shooting, who continued up the street, gun still visible, in the direction of Burleson.

When the second group of policemen arrived, 15 to 20 minutes later, five of the policemen followed the suspect in the shooting and tried to alleviate the situation, said McManus.

McManus said the suspect said to a captain at the scene, “I’m not putting my gun down.”

The shooting suspect entered an empty field and police officers used a Taser to try to subdue him, according to the chief. He then shot the police, and five of them fired back, hitting him several times, said McManus.

None of the policemen were injured in the shooting.

The suspect in the shooting was taken to the Brooke Army Medical Center, where he died of his injuries.

The victim shot in the apartment complex was taken to the hospital in critical condition. The boss said he was stable at the last check.

Directors, whose career at SAPD ranges from three to 19 years, will be placed in administrative roles.

McManus said the information provided during his briefing is preliminary and is subject to change with further investigations.
